環境

  • MetroCluster FC
  • Brocadeスイッチ

問題

スイッチファームウェアのダウンロードまたはコミットに失敗しました:
 
switch:admin> firmwaredownload
..
Checking system settings for firmwaredownload...
Sanity check failed because firmwareDownload is already in progress.
..

switch:admin> firmwarecommit
Failed to open sysid output file: Read-only file system
Validating the filesystem ...


Repairing the secondary partition now.
Please wait ...
rsync: delete_file: unlink "/mnt/usr/lib/.libxml2.so.2.9.4.UOcCrY" failed: Read-only file system (30)
rsync: mkstemp "/mnt/bin/.basename.6xbXrs" failed: Read-only file system (30)
rsync: mkstemp "/mnt/bin/.bash.OaaFOK" failed: Read-only file system (30)
.
.
.
rsync: mkstemp "/mnt/var/lib/rpm/.providesindex.rpm.x4GUIk" failed: Read-only file system (30)
rsync: mkstemp "/mnt/var/lib/rpm/.requiredby.rpm.8ykgtq" failed: Read-only file system (30)
rsync: mkstemp "/mnt/var/lib/rpm/.triggerindex.rpm.FjLYgF" failed: Read-only file system (30)
rsync error: some files could not be transferred (code 23) at main.c(977) [sender=2.6.9]
Failed to synchronize the partitions (0x1700).
Please reboot the switch and run the firmwarecommit command.
If the issue persists, Replace the CF card.
